这里主要讲的是用MySQLConnector的源代码进行连接
一:下载MySQLConnector源代码
首先去MySQL官网下载MySQL connector/C++的源代码
根据自己系统平台下载相应的版本。我下载使用的是Connector/C++ 1.1.6。
二:重新编译mysqlcppconn.lib-static
和连接方式一种的编译mysqlcppconn.dll、mysqlcppconn.lib的方式是一样的,这里不在啰嗦。其中需要注意的一点,注意在编译的时候选择是debug版还是release版。
三:下面要配置vs2013的环境。
1. 项目属性页->C/C++->General->Additional Include Directories。将mysql\include目录添加进去。
2. 项目属性页->Linker->General->Additional Library Directories。将mysql\lib与$MySQL\bin目录添加进去。
3. 项目属性页->Linker->Input->Additional Dependencies。添加这两项mysqlcppconn-static.lib,libmysql.lib(mysql\lib目录下的两个.lib文件)
四:简要连接步骤代码
连接步骤和代码和连接方式一的一样,这里也不在啰嗦。